A strong debut from Exeter based James Lusby.
'Pelican Hill' has been cleverly produced to create a diverse listening experience.
James had previously played in bands but felt it was time to go solo as he could have full creative control over his songs and his sound. James performs, writes and records his own music and has performed live at venues across the country.
The title track 'Pelican Hill', begins with a dance vibe then smashes into a big stage anthem of guitars and drums with the chorus ringing 'Take me away, take me away!'. Definitely one for the air guitar.
Other stand out tracks include body rocking 'Start Again', 'Poetic Justice' (which sounds like an intense version of Keane's 'Is it any wonder') and the uplifting and jazzy 'Fear of Loneliness' which will have you 'oooo'ing' along.
His diverse sound also has hints of Snow Patrol and Jeff Buckley and he demonstrates his musical creativity with some hypnotic instrumental solos. There are no 'filler' tracks on this record; each track has a unique presence and purpose.
It is truly one album that should be listened to in its entirety every time.
